Introduction
Estimate bundles are item bundles which can be used to make creating new estimates quicker and easier. Instead of always creating a frequently used estimate from scratch, you can create a new estimate quickly by using an estimate bundle as a template.
In addition to estimate bundles, you can use an existing estimate as a template for a new one by copying an existing treatment estimate.
1. Create a new estimate bundle.
You can start creating a new bundle from three places:
- Go to Clients & Patients > Estimates and select +Estimate bundle.
- Go Settings > Items & Lists > Bundles and select +Add.
- Open an existing estimate and select Create bundle. The items included in the estimate are copied to the new bundle.
Select the settings and add items to the estimate bundle in the same way as for an item bundle.
When you want to use a bundle as an estimate bundle, select the Estimate bundle checkbox in the bundle settings. When you start from Clients & Patients > Estimates, the checkbox is selected by default.
2. Create an estimate using a bundle.
- Create a new treatment estimate.
- When adding items to the estimate, select Bundles.
- All available item and estimate bundles are listed in the Treatment item bundles dialogue. Select the bundle you want to use.
- In the Add treatment items to estimate dialogue, select the items you want to add to the estimate. You can edit the item quantities and prices.
- If you only want to include the bundle title and not the individual items included in the bundle on the finalised estimate printout, select the Show only bundle title on finalised estimate checkbox.
- Select Add and continue to finalising the estimate.
